- Korean Exchange Program July 6th - July 24th (2021)
- Program cost: $3,000
- Students accepted into the exchange program will host a middle school Korean student in their home in January. In July students in the program will travel to Changwon South Korea with 15 of their peers to spend 2 weeks learning of Korean culture and touring the country.
